What We Accept
Poetry & Short Stories
Poem Stellium welcomes original poetry of all styles and forms, including free verse, haiku, sonnets, spoken word, prose poetry, experimental poetry, and rhyming poetry.
We also welcome original short stories across a range of themes and genres.
We are drawn to work that explores emotion, experience, memory, identity, imagination, or inner life. The work does not need to follow one particular style, but it should feel sincere, reflective, and thoughtfully crafted.
Please note that, while we honour the form and intention of each piece, selected work may be presented in Poem Stellium’s house style for publication.

Submission Process
When submissions are open, contributors may submit one piece per category during each submission period.
All submissions are made through a private form, which is provided after payment.
Submission Fee
A submission fee of £2.22 is required when submissions are open.
This supports the ongoing running of Poem Stellium, including platform maintenance, development, and the time involved in reviewing and curating submissions.
For those who wish to support the platform further, there is the option to contribute more.
Payment does not guarantee publication. All work is selected based on quality, intention, and alignment with the space.

Guidelines
• One submission per category during each submission period
• Work must be your own original writing and must not have been previously published
• Submissions must be in English
• External links are not accepted
• Simultaneous submissions are allowed, but please notify us if your work is accepted elsewhere
• Submissions are open to contributors worldwide
Selection Process
All work is read with care once submissions have closed.
If your submission is selected, you will be contacted after the submission period ends.
Due to the volume of submissions, individual feedback is not provided.
If you do not hear from us within one month of submissions closing, your work was not selected, and you are welcome to submit again during a future open call.
To allow space for a range of voices, contributors who have been recently published through an open call may be asked to wait before submitting again.
Rights & Publication
You retain full copyright of your work.
If your work is selected, you grant Poem Stellium a non-exclusive right to publish the accepted piece on its platform and associated channels.
Once published, the work becomes part of the Poem Stellium archive.
You are free to republish your work elsewhere, including in personal collections or future publications. Where possible, we ask that Poem Stellium is credited as the original place of publication.
Requests for removal will be considered on reasonable grounds.
Editing & Presentation
All published work appears in Poem Stellium’s house style.
Minor edits, such as spelling or punctuation, may be suggested where necessary. You will always be contacted and asked to approve any changes before publication.
